Abstract
WE have found that it is possible to make photoelectric cells of the Elster-Geitel type sensitive to the extreme red, and having a colour sensitivity approaching that of the eye much more nearly than those used at present. The new cells have a limit above 700μμ and a very useful sensitivity at 650μμ; their sensitivity extends also to the violet limit of the visible spectrum, and their total sensitivity to white light is of the same order as that of existing cells.
